La automatización, el cloud y el cambio cultural son claves para lograrlo con éxito
Un estudio del proveedor de servicios gestionados Claranet revela que las empresas europeas mantienen su interés en adoptar una aproximación DevOps hacia los servicios, muchas de ellas esperando escalar sus esfuerzos como parte de una más amplia filosofía application-first. A pesar de esto, existen aún obstáculos que superar para la mayoría de los departamentos de TI que quieren adoptar DevOps como modus operandi, sobretodo en términos de uso y automatización del cloud, requeridos para lograrlo.
El estudio expone que el 29% de las empresas ya han realizado la transición a una aproximación DevOps y un 54% esperan hacerlo en los próximos dos años. Una señal positiva, pues los negocios esperan sacar el máximo provecho de la revolución del software y están dando pasos hacia convertirse en lo más ágiles que puedan, una apuesta por la mejora de la experiencia del cliente.
Acerca de los resultados del estudio, Michel Robert, Director General de Claranet UK, aplaude el deseo de los líderes de las TI de comprometerse sin reparos con la filosofía DevOps: “Aprovechar y mantener la ventaja competitiva requiere que las empresas sean ambiciosas, adaptables y abiertas a aproximaciones frescas. Es alentador que cada vez sean más conscientes de los beneficios que ofrece adoptar una visión centrada en la aplicación, en términos de mayor agilidad de negocio e incremento de la eficiencia operativa”.
No obstante, aún existen barreras que impiden aprovechar al máximo esta filosofía. Casi el 74% de los que han migrado al enfoque DevOps han topado con retos de algún tipo. Los propios equipos de operaciones limitando el potencial de DevOps es el reto más común entre los líderes TI (en un 26% de los casos), seguido de una falta de objetivos de negocio claros dentro de la estructura directiva, que dificulta la definición de la estrategia DevOps (25%).
Para ayudar a atenuar estas cuestiones, Robert cree que los responsables de TI deben aumentar sus esfuerzos en automatizar aplicaciones y procesos mediante un uso completo de las capacidades del cloud, así como fomentar un cambio cultural gradual con el que todos los miembros del departamento de TI puedan unirse a la filosofía DevOps.
“El enfoque DevOps no puede ser implementado de la noche a la mañana. Requiere de un periodo de cambio reiterativo en el que tanto la tecnología como las personas de la organización deben ser preparadas. Incrementar la automatización es esencial para lograr la agilidad que caracteriza una aproximación DevOps de éxito, de manera que las empresas deben dar pasos adicionales para implementar nuevas medidas que lo faciliten. Un modo de hacer esto es pasar del énfasis en la integración continua (CI) al énfasis en el desarrollo continuo (CD). Efectivamente, este método permite ir de las actualizaciones de aplicaciones trimestrales a poder lanzar actualizaciones una o dos veces a la semana. Combinar esto con la flexibilidad de la nube aportará el máximo beneficio”, añade Robert.
Robert remarca la importancia del cambio cultural en la empresa para asegurar el éxito de la integración de DevOps a una escala más amplia: “Automatización y procesos como el desarrollo continuo (CD) son clave, pero solo pueden realizarse en su máximo potencial si todo el equipo de TI va en el mismo barco respecto a cualquier cambio. Los cambios deben hacerse de manera gradual, teniendo en mente objetivos a largo plazo, y los equipos de TI deben tener claro que sus puestos de trabajo no serán usurpados por la automatización, sino que les dará capacidad para hacer cosas más interesantes para el negocio”.